Why LocaleSweep? #
Your app looks perfect in English. Then a German user opens Settings and "Benachrichtigungseinstellungen" overflows the row. An Arabic user sees left-aligned text. A Japanese user hits an untranslated screen. You find out from a 1-star review.
LocaleSweep catches these before your users do. It multiplies a single test across every combination of locale, text scale, viewport, and brightness — then captures a golden screenshot of each variant and fails only the ones that break.

What it catches #
| # | Category | How |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Text overflow | Intercepts RenderFlex overflow errors — German compound words, Arabic text expansion, CJK line wrapping |
| 2 | Missing ARB keys | Finds keys present in app_en.arb but absent in target locale ARB files |
| 3 | Placeholder mismatches | Verifies {count}, {name}, etc. from base locale appear in every translation |
| 4 | Untranslated strings | Flags keys where the translation is identical to the base locale — likely copy-paste that was never translated |
| 5 | Golden regression | Pixel-level comparison against committed baselines — catches unintended visual changes |
| 6 | Accessibility scaling | Renders at 2x text scale to catch layouts that break for large-text users |
| 7 | RTL layout | Auto-detects 10 RTL locales (Arabic, Hebrew, Farsi, Urdu, Kurdish, Pashto, Yiddish, Dhivehi, Sindhi, Uyghur) — including subtags like ar_EG |
| 8 | Dark mode regressions | Tests both light and dark brightness with proper Theme wrapping — catches hardcoded colors and contrast issues |

Dark mode testing #
Enable darkMode: true to automatically test every variant in both light and dark brightness. LocaleSweep wraps your widget in a Theme so Theme.of(context) works correctly inside your builder.
sweepTest(
'settings',
builder: () => const SettingsPage(),
darkMode: true,
);
// Each locale/scale/viewport variant is now tested in both light and dark
Custom themes #
Pass your app's actual ThemeData to catch real theme-specific issues:
sweepTest(
'settings',
builder: () => const SettingsPage(),
darkMode: true,
lightTheme: AppTheme.light, // your ThemeData.light() variant
darkTheme: AppTheme.dark, // your ThemeData.dark() variant
);
When darkMode is enabled without custom themes, LocaleSweep uses ThemeData.light() and ThemeData.dark() as defaults. When darkMode is disabled (the default), no Theme wrapper is added unless you explicitly pass a theme.
You can also enable dark mode globally in locale_sweep.yaml:
dark_mode: true

Skipping variants #
Exclude specific combinations from the test matrix using the skip callback. Useful for known issues, platform-specific flows, or reducing CI time:
sweepTest(
'settings',
builder: () => const SettingsPage(),
locales: ['en', 'de', 'ar', 'ja'],
textScales: [1.0, 2.0],
darkMode: true,
skip: (variant) {
// Skip Japanese at 2x — known issue, tracked in JIRA-1234
if (variant.locale == 'ja' && variant.textScale == 2.0) return true;
// Skip dark mode for tablet — not supported yet
if (variant.isDark && variant.viewport == ViewportPreset.tablet) return true;
return false;
},
);
Skipped variants appear as ~ (skipped) in Flutter's test output, not as failures.

Config validation #
LocaleSweep warns on stderr about typos and type mismatches in your YAML config, so silent misconfiguration doesn't waste CI runs:
Warning: Unknown keys in locale_sweep.yaml: locale, text_scale
Valid keys: locales, text_scales, viewports, dark_mode, screenshot_dir, report_dir, arb_dir
Warning: "locales" in locale_sweep.yaml should be a list, got String.
Invalid YAML or missing files fall back to sensible defaults.

--fail-on — control what fails CI #
By default, any issue (overflow, ARB, golden mismatch) fails the run. Use --fail-on to control which categories trigger a non-zero exit code:
# Only fail on overflows and golden mismatches — treat ARB issues as warnings
dart run locale_sweep run --fail-on overflow,golden
# Fail on everything (default)
dart run locale_sweep run --fail-on all
# Never fail — report-only mode, useful for initial adoption
dart run locale_sweep run --fail-on none
# Only fail on ARB translation issues
dart run locale_sweep run --fail-on arb
Categories: overflow, arb, golden, all, none

How it works #
| Step | What happens |
|---|---|
| 1 | sweepTest() expands locales x scales x viewports x brightness into individual testWidgets calls |
| 2 | Each test configures the Flutter test view with the target viewport, locale, text scale, and platform brightness |
| 3 | Your widget is pumped inside Directionality + MediaQuery + Theme wrappers |
| 4 | OverflowDetector hooks into FlutterError.onError to capture RenderFlex overflow |
| 5 | matchesGoldenFile saves or compares the screenshot |
| 6 | ArbAnalyzer runs static analysis on ARB JSON files — no rendering needed |
| 7 | Results are recorded before assertions — screenshots always exist, even for broken variants |
| 8 | Each flow writes results to .locale_sweep/results/{flowName}.json for CLI aggregation |
Real-world validation #
Tested against two popular open-source Flutter apps:
| App | Stars | Result |
|---|---|---|
| Spotube | 48k+ | 0 issues across de/ar/ja/fr/es/ko/zh — zero false positives |
| wger | 960+ | 165 missing Arabic keys, 1 placeholder mismatch, 301 missing Hebrew keys — all real bugs |
Zero noise on complete translations. Real findings on incomplete ones.
